Exemplo n.º 1
0
        public TrackOptionShipPresenter(IUnityContainer container, ITrackOptionShipView view)
        {
            View           = view;
            this.container = container;
            this.service   = new WMSServiceClient();
            //this.region = region;
            View.Model = this.container.Resolve <TrackOptionShipModel>();

            //Event Delegate
            View.LoadQuantity += new EventHandler <DataEventArgs <Label> >(View_LoadQuantity);
            View.PickToList   += new EventHandler <EventArgs>(View_PickToList);
            View.LoadSetup    += new EventHandler <EventArgs>(View_LoadSetup);

            View.PickUniqueLabel   += new EventHandler <DataEventArgs <string> >(View_PickUniqueLabel);
            View.RemoveUniqueTrack += new EventHandler <EventArgs>(View_RemoveUniqueTrack);
        }
        public TrackOptionShipPresenter(IUnityContainer container, ITrackOptionShipView view)
        {
            View = view;
            this.container = container;
            this.service = new WMSServiceClient();
            //this.region = region;
            View.Model = this.container.Resolve<TrackOptionShipModel>();

            //Event Delegate
            View.LoadQuantity += new EventHandler<DataEventArgs<Label>>(View_LoadQuantity);
            View.PickToList += new EventHandler<EventArgs>(View_PickToList);
            View.LoadSetup += new EventHandler<EventArgs>(View_LoadSetup);

            View.PickUniqueLabel += new EventHandler<DataEventArgs<string>>(View_PickUniqueLabel);
            View.RemoveUniqueTrack += new EventHandler<EventArgs>(View_RemoveUniqueTrack);

        }